- In today's video, I go over the principles of how to scale the airflow model on a Gen 3 LS Based ecm to properly work with boost. We discuss one of the most critical steps which is scaling your injectors.

Just a tip, you don’t have to copy and paste every row on the VE (timestamp 9:25 ish) you can highlight the entire table, right click and select “copy with axis”, then go to the other table and click paste and it will only paste the relevant cells

Using power enrichment for boost is a big mistake. If your fuel trims are swinging negative when you floor it, it locks the negative factor in and subtracts from the enrichment fuel. I chased my tail because of this. I disabled all PE and tuned the VE table and my fueling is constant. Believe me when you are running over 20psi you don’t want it running any leaner that what you set it at. Just a heads up. Do whatever makes you comfortable
